Common Causes of System Breaks

Sub-Zero Temperatures and Systems

Frozen pipes are a leading cause of bursts during Melbourne’s cooler months. When water freezes inside a pipe, it expands—creating extreme pressure that can rupture even strong materials like copper or PVC. Older homes in suburbs like Northcote and Richmond are especially vulnerable due to outdated insulation and exposed piping.

Old Pipe Components and Corrosion

Homes built before the 1990s often have galvanised steel or cast iron pipes that are now reaching end-of-life. Pipe decay weakens the walls, increasing the risk of sudden failures. You might notice discoloured water, low pressure, or recurring clogs—all signs you need urgent plumbing attention.

A licensed plumber can conduct a full pipe integrity test to determine if repiping with PVC piping is necessary. Proactive replacement prevents disasters and improves water quality and flow.

Elevated Line Stress

Over-pressurised systems can silently damage your plumbing, leading to premature wear and unexpected bursts. Ideal pressure is between 40–55 psi; anything higher increases the strain on joints, fixtures, and pipes—especially in older homes with copper lines.

  • Fit a pressure-reducing valve to regulate flow
  • Test pressure with a gauge at least once a year
  • Look out for signs like banging pipes or leaking taps

Drain Relining and Underground Repair

Trenchless rehabilitation is a advanced solution that avoids destructive digging. Using composite liner, we create a new pipe within the old one—sealing cracks, holes, and root intrusions without excavation. It’s faster, cleaner, and often more cost-effective than traditional methods.

Ideal for backyard-sensitive sites, this trenchless pipe repair works for stormwater, sewage, and supply lines. Most jobs are completed in a single day with minimal disruption and a full lifetime guarantee.

Obvious Moisture Marks

Damp patches on ceilings, walls, or floors are red flags for an ongoing leak. These often start small but can quickly lead to ceiling collapse if ignored. In older buildings, leaks behind tiling or under flooring may go unnoticed for weeks—causing extensive foundation issues.
